External factors. External factors in SWOT analysis are opportunities and threats. Often, these factors are out of your control. But by identifying them, you can plan for outcomes. Proper planning is how businesses continue to thrive decades after opening. Identifying company opportunities and threats are critical for planning.

Feb 2, 2021 · SWOT stands for Strengths, Weaknesses, Opportunities, and Threats. Strengths and weaknesses are internal to your company—things that you have some control over and can change. Examples include who is on your team, your patents and intellectual property, and your location. Opportunities and threats are external—things that are going on ...
